Climate overview of Melle
Melle, Poitou-Charentes, France, sees big temperature differences between seasons, with August peaking at 27°C (81°F) and February dropping to 10°C (50°F).
With around 877 mm (35 in) of annual rain/snowfall, the city has moderate precipitation levels. December is the wettest month and July the driest. The most sunshine falls in July, with an average of 9.0 hours of daily sunshine.

Monthly Temperature in Melle
Visitors to Melle can expect significant temperature changes throughout the year. Typically, average maximum daytime temperatures range from a comfortable 27°C (81°F) in August to a chilly 10°C (50°F) in the coolest month, February.
Nights vary from 15°C (59°F) in August to around 2°C (36°F) during the colder months.

Rainfall in Melle
Generally, Melle experiences moderate precipitation patterns, averaging 877 mm (35 in) yearly. Melle offers a pleasant mix of wetter and slightly drier months. The difference in precipitation between the wettest month December (90 mm (3.5 in)) and the driest month July (52 mm (2 in)) is not too significant. Sunshine Hours in Melle
For those who appreciate different seasons, Melle serves as an ideal destination. Expect longer, more sun-filled days in July with an average of 9.0 hours of sunshine daily, and embrace the darker days in December, offering only 2.2 hours of daily sunlight.

Frequently asked questions about the climate in Melle
What is the best time to visit Melle?
May, June, July, August and September typically offer the most optimal weather in Melle. In contrast, January and December tend to have less optimal conditions.
What temperatures can I expect in Melle?
Daytime highs range from 10°C (50°F) in February to 27°C (81°F) in August. Nighttime lows range from 2°C (36°F) to 15°C (59°F). Temperatures vary considerably through the year.
How much rain does Melle get?
Annual rainfall is around 877 mm (35 in). December is the wettest month with 90 mm (3.5 in), while July is the driest with 52 mm (2 in).
How sunny is Melle?
Melle receives around 1,988 hours of sunshine per year. July is the sunniest month with 269 hours, while December is the cloudiest with just 66 hours.
